Description

Animal bones and teeth. Includes one phalange and a fragmented humerus likely from a cow; a pig canine and sheep molar. Four bones present.

Context (Field collection)
Site AR IV, Manor Farm, excavated by David Trump, 1965-1966.

Manor Farm Arbury Road excavations, 1965-1969 (Event no. ECB359). See archive for unpublished reports (Doc.493-Doc.497 and GO3/3/41).
